Say No to GLOP in Leadership Training! (Video Blog)

It’s so easy to GLOP! What is GLOP? It stands for General Labeling Of People. When was the last time you said something like “Man, he is just so stubborn!” Yep, that’s Glopping. You just label the person as “stubborn” instead of identifying and describing the specific behavior, which makes it difficult to confront the person and to then resolve issues or conflicts. In leadership training, it is important to stress avoiding labels. Tim M., an L.E.T. Trainer, uses one of his past experiences to illustrate the advantages of GLOP avoidance in effective leadership.
